/******* Do not edit this file *******
Simple Custom CSS and JS - by Silkypress.com
Saved: May 30 2023 | 05:05:38 */
.footerfollowus .elementor-icon-box-content .elementor-icon-box-title {
    font-size: 17px;
}
.header-logo .elementor-widget-container a img{
	width:245px;
}
.headerLogin-btn .elementor-button-wrapper a{
	border-radius: 6px 6px 6px 6px;
    padding: 15px 30px 15px 30px;
	font-size:1.2rem!important;
}
.banner-subtext .elementor-widget-container p{
	opacity:0.75;
}
.learnMoreBtn .elementor-widget-container a{
	font-weight:700;
}
.learnMoreBtn .elementor-widget-container a:hover{
	text-decoration: none;
}
.homeCounter .elementor-counter .elementor-counter-title{
	padding-top:10px;
}
.BgBtnType1 .elementor-button-wrapper a:hover{
	background-color: #233e7d!important;
}
.memberlogorows .elementor-column.elementor-col-33.elementor-inner-column.elementor-element {
    width: 66px;
    margin: 0px 10px;
}
.arrowBtnStyle .elementor-button-wrapper a{
	background-color: #1b2a4e!important;
	    fill: #fff!important;
    color: #fff!important;
}
.arrowBtnStyle .elementor-button-wrapper a:hover{
	background-color: #6C8AEC!important;
}
.aboutTradewindCardWrap .elementor-column.elementor-col-33.elementor-inner-column.elementor-element .elementor-icon-box-wrapper .elementor-icon{
	 font-size: 35px!important;
}
.outlined-btn .elementor-button-wrapper a{
	 background-color: #fff;
    color: #335eea;
    border: 1px solid #335eea!important;
}
.elementor-section.elementor-section-stretched {
    width: 100%!important;
}
.job_listings {
    border-color: #094286 !important;
    border: 1px solid #094286;
    padding: 10px;
    border-radius: 10px;
	box-shadow: 0 1.5rem 4rem rgba(22, 28, 45, 0.1) !important;
}
.job_listings form.job_filters {
    background: #ebebeb;
    padding: 10px;
    border-radius: 10px;
	box-shadow:none !important;
}
ul.job_listings.list-unstyled.bg-white.mb-7 {
    border: 1px solid #fff!important;
    border-radius: 0px!important;
	box-shadow: none!important;
}
.type-job_listing .job-listing__meta {
    display: none!important;
}
.type-job_listing>.position-static+.position-static {
    font-size: 0.9rem;
    font-weight: 600;
	padding: 15px 20px;
}
a.text-reset.text-decoration-none.stretched-link {
    padding-left: 13px!important;
}
ul.job_listings__header li span {
    font-size: 17px;
}
@media (max-width:600px){
	.sub-menu li {
		padding: 0px;
		border-top: 1px solid #dbdbdb!important;
	}
}